While a basic electrician capably manages domestic electrical wiring, business fit-outs, and a broad spectrum of internal electrical systems, the Level 2 accredited provider (ASP) operates on a different plane totally. Their domain is the connection point, the extremely conduit between the energy's network and your home's electrical setup.

Think of it in this manner: your home may have a wonderful internal plumbing system, but without the primary water line from the street, it's read more simply a collection of pipes. Likewise, a Level 2 electrician is responsible for that essential connection to the external electrical power grid. Their knowledge covers a variety of specialised jobs that are beyond the scope of a standard electrical licence. This includes work on service mains, which are the cable televisions that range from the street pole or underground pillar straight to your meter box. They're the ones who can safely link and detach your property from the network, a crucial task for brand-new builds, major renovations, and even power upgrades.

One of the main responsibilities of a Level 2 ASP is the setup and repair of numerous kinds of service lines. This encompasses overhead service mains, those familiar wires strung between power poles and your roofing system, and likewise underground service mains, the significantly common buried cable televisions. They have the specialised training and devices to work safely at heights or in trenches, often in close proximity to live electrical energy. This isn't a task for the faint of heart, or certainly, for anybody without the extensive accreditation required.

Beyond new connections, Level 2 electricians are also instrumental in keeping the stability of existing facilities. Ought to your service mains be damaged by a falling branch, a vehicle effect, or simply age, it's the Level 2 specialist who will be hired to evaluate the damage, ensure the location is safe, and carry out the needed repair work. They understand the intricacies of network guidelines and security protocols, ensuring that any work carried out comply with the greatest requirements, protecting both property and individuals.

Metering is another significant area within the Level 2 scope. While a basic electrician might link your internal electrical wiring to the meter, it is the Level 2 ASP who is authorised to set up, relocate, or upgrade the real electrical energy meter itself. This is particularly pertinent for new developments, when switching to solar power, or when updating your property's electrical capability to manage increased demand from devices like cooling or electrical lorry chargers. Their understanding of metering policies and network requirements is vital for precise billing and efficient power usage.

In addition, these experts are typically associated with more intricate situations like power upgrades. If a home, or even a small commercial establishment, needs a significant increase in its power supply-- possibly from single-phase to three-phase power-- a Level 2 electrician is essential. They will evaluate the existing network connection, determine the needed capability, and perform the required upgrades to the service mains and metering devices to safely provide the increased power.

The training and licensing for Level 2 electricians are extensive and rigid. They undergo extremely specialised courses that concentrate on network safety, overhead and underground service work, and metering procedures. This strenuous accreditation ensures they possess the extensive knowledge and practical skills to work securely and efficiently on the live network, minimising threats to themselves and the public. Routine audits and ongoing expert advancement are likewise typically needed to preserve their accreditation, ensuring their abilities stay current with developing technologies and guidelines.
